How To Fix Cannot Modify Header Information In WordPress:
From time to time, the smallest things may cause errors to WordPress (Warning: Cannot modify header information). Headers that are earlier transmitted via WordPress issues are really the most concerned. Because of it, you may not be able to log in from the dashboard of a user. As a result, it impedes the proper management of the site.
The problem is most of the time seen in a vacant page in a mistake log hinting to the headers early sent by error, in the condition that WP_DEBUG is determined “true” (more info down). A path of a file and the exact line are behind this issue. Hence, on the screen, your eye will see such a thing displayed:
Warning: Cannot modify header information – headers already sent by (output started at /some/file.php:12) in /some/file-2.php on line X.
The causes of this issue are numerous. However, whitespaces are the utmost ordinary problems, whether they exist after the ?> or before <?PHP segment of the code.
Step By Step On How To Fix Cannot Modify Header Information In WordPress:
First, Beforehand, you need to reach the error log. Via a File Transfer Protocol (FTP) client such as FileZilla, accessing the error log can be done. All you have to do is to look for the wp-config.php file, then set WP_DEBUG on true.
Second, head to your login page that is commonly your-site-URL/wp-admin then check the shown error message.
Below, there is a model:
Warning: Cannot modify header information – headers already sent by (output started at wp-contentthemestheme_nameframeworkmoduleswoocommercewidgetswoocommerce-dropdown-cartwoocommerce-dropdown-cart.php:121) in /wp-includes/pluggable.php on line 922
The above lines convey a message: Via FTP you should go to this path:
Then, in that file, locate the said 121st line of code.
The majority of the issues will be solved the moment, in the specified file, you eliminate the vacant space after or before this line.
Third move: Save the file then employ it to nullify the current one after the modifications have already taken place. Accept a ticket that clarifies the issue and allow our assistance team to help you if you find yourself in unease doing these modifications by yourself. Hence, your FTP credentials should take part in your ticket.